Fitment questions

Will a door from an earlier Fiat Qubo fit my newer one?

The Fiat Qubo was produced as a single generation running from 2008 to 2017, so doors from across that range are generally considered the same generation. However, whether a door from a specific year will physically interchange with yours is something you should confirm with the breaker against your registration, as minor running changes can occur through a production run. Always give the breaker your reg so they can verify the exact match before you buy.

Does the number of doors on a Fiat Qubo affect which door I need?

Yes, the Qubo was available as both a 3-door and 5-door body, and the front doors differ between these variants, so you must match the door count of your vehicle. When requesting a quote, tell the breaker whether your Qubo is a 3-door or 5-door as well as which side you need. Getting this wrong means the door will not fit correctly regardless of the year.

What does NS and OS mean when searching for a Fiat Qubo door, and which side do I need?

NS stands for nearside, which is the passenger side (left when sitting in the car), and OS stands for offside, which is the driver's side (right in a UK right-hand-drive vehicle). Check which door is damaged or missing on your Qubo and order accordingly, as a nearside door cannot be swapped to the offside. Breakers will use these terms when listing parts, so knowing your side will speed up getting an accurate quote.

I have a Fiat Qubo Active - will a door from a Dynamic or Multijet trim fit it?

Trim level does not affect door fitment on the Fiat Qubo; the door frame and shell are the same across Active, Dynamic, and other trim variants for the same body style and side. What may differ is the glass, mirror specification, or window regulator type, and whether your specific vehicle has electric or manual features is something to confirm with the breaker against your registration. You should also expect that a door from a different trim may arrive in a different colour, but this is cosmetic and can be resprayed.

Does the colour of a used Fiat Qubo door matter for fitment?

Colour is purely cosmetic and has no bearing on whether a door will physically fit your Qubo. You should shop for the correct generation, body style, and side rather than hunting for a matching colour, since a correctly fitting door in a different shade can always be resprayed. Focusing on colour over fitment is one of the most common reasons buyers end up with a door that does not suit their vehicle.

I have a Fiat Qubo van - is there anything extra I need to check before buying a rear or side door?

On van variants of the Qubo, the rear side door is typically a sliding door, and you should confirm with the breaker that the door on offer matches the sliding configuration of your vehicle. If your van has a hinged rear door arrangement instead, the parts will not be interchangeable with a sliding setup, so be specific when requesting your quote. Give the breaker your registration to help them identify the exact configuration your vehicle left the factory with.
